COOKTOPS MARKET OVERVIEW
The global cooktops market size was USD 14.340 billion in 2025 and is projected to touch USD 19.540 billion by 2033,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.3% during the forecast period.
Cooktops are essential kitchen appliances designed for cooking food using direct heat. Available in gas, electric, and induction types, they offer inflexibility grounded on user preferences and energy sources. Gas cooktops give instant honey control, while electric ones insure even heating. Induction cooktops known for energy efficiency and safety, use electromagnetic fields to heat cookware directly. Cooktops come in various sizes and configurations, including erected- in or freestanding models, frequently featuring advanced controls, timekeepers, and safety features. With satiny designs and durable materials like stainless steel or glass, modern cooktops enhance both functionality and aesthetics in residential and commercial kitchens.

LATEST TRENDS
"Wireless Power Integration via Ki Standard to Drive Market Growth"
Recent traits inside the cooktops industry include the rapid rise of mobile cooktops. A major evolving trend is integrating Ki wireless power into cooktops, enabling appliances like kettles and blenders to receive power inductively—up to 2,200 W—directly from the cooktop or countertop surface. Though innovative, the system raises questions around energy inefficiency, heat loss, and device alignment requirements. Proponents argue it supports cable-free convenience and cleaner kitchen aesthetics, while critics point to practicality and environmental concerns. Still, major brands and WPC’s Ki standard back the push, marking a potential shift toward cordless, integrated kitchen power solutions.
COOKTOPS MARKET SEGMENTATION
BY TYPE
Based on Type, the global market can be categorized into Gas Cooktops, Electric Cooktops and Others
- Gas Cooktops: A gas cooktops uses an open honey to give moment and malleable heat for cuisine. Preferred by professional cookers and home culinarians likewise, it offers precise temperature control and fast heating. It generally includes multiple burners and is compatible with a wide range of cookware materials.
- Electric Cooktops: Electric cooktops use heated coils or smooth glass shells with bedded heating rudiments to cook food. They offer harmonious heat distribution and are easy to clean, especially the smooth-top variants. Though slower to heat than gas, they give steady temperatures and are ideal for modern, minimalist kitchen designs.
- Others: Other types of cooktops include induction, ceramic, and modular cooktops. Induction cooktops use electromagnetic energy for presto, effective heating. Ceramic cooktops feature a satiny, glass surface with radiant heat rudiments. Modular cooktops offer customization, combining gas, electric, or specialty burners like grills or deep toasters for protean cuisine requirements.

CHALLENGE
"Compatibility and Consumer Awareness Issues Could Be a Potential Challenge for Consumers"
A crucial challenge in the cooktops market is the limited comity of induction cooktops with traditional cookware, which can discourage implicit buyers. Induction technology requires specific magnetic based pots and pans, prompting fresh purchases that increase overall cost. Likewise, numerous consumers remain ignorant of how induction cooktops work or perceive them as complex, leading to vacillation in relinquishment. In developing regions, lack of mindfulness, artistic preferences for gas cuisine and inconsistent electricity force further hamper market growth. Prostrating these challenges requires targeted education, demonstration juggernauts, and affordable, stoner-friendly product immolations to drive wide acceptance of modern cooktop technologies.
